Two Punjabis killed in Gwadar

15 March, 2013

According to police head mohrar Mohrar Bashir Ahmed, unidentified armed pillion riders opened indiscriminate fire at a shop located at Qandeel Chowk, Gwadar, killing two people on the spot.

"Police rushed to the site after the incident and sifted the victims to a hospital for medico-legal formalities where they were identified as Munawar, son of Ibrahim, and Zahid, son of Yaseen. Both were residents of Rahimyar Khan, Punjab," Ahmed said.

The deceased used to run a welding shop and the incident seemed to be a case of target killing, he added.
